import { Func, Aggregate } from "../ir.js"; import { toExpression } from "./ref-proxy.js"; function eq(left, right) { return new Func(`eq`, [toExpression(left), toExpression(right)]); } function gt(left, right) { return new Func(`gt`, [toExpression(left), toExpression(right)]); } function gte(left, right) { return new Func(`gte`, [toExpression(left), toExpression(right)]); } function lt(left, right) { return new Func(`lt`, [toExpression(left), toExpression(right)]); } function lte(left, right) { return new Func(`lte`, [toExpression(left), toExpression(right)]); } function and(left, right, ...rest) { const allArgs = [left, right, ...rest]; return new Func( `and`, allArgs.map((arg) => toExpression(arg)) ); } function or(left, right, ...rest) { const allArgs = [left, right, ...rest]; return new Func( `or`, allArgs.map((arg) => toExpression(arg)) ); } function not(value) { return new Func(`not`, [toExpression(value)]); } function inArray(value, array) { return new Func(`in`, [toExpression(value), toExpression(array)]); } function like(left, right) { return new Func(`like`, [toExpression(left), toExpression(right)]); } function ilike(left, right) { return new Func(`ilike`, [toExpression(left), toExpression(right)]); } function upper(arg) { return new Func(`upper`, [toExpression(arg)]); } function lower(arg) { return new Func(`lower`, [toExpression(arg)]); } function length(arg) { return new Func(`length`, [toExpression(arg)]); } function concat(...args) { return new Func( `concat`, args.map((arg) => toExpression(arg)) ); } function coalesce(...args) { return new Func( `coalesce`, args.map((arg) => toExpression(arg)) ); } function add(left, right) { return new Func(`add`, [toExpression(left), toExpression(right)]); } function count(arg) { return new Aggregate(`count`, [toExpression(arg)]); } function avg(arg) { return new Aggregate(`avg`, [toExpression(arg)]); } function sum(arg) { return new Aggregate(`sum`, [toExpression(arg)]); } function min(arg) { return new Aggregate(`min`, [toExpression(arg)]); } function max(arg) { return new Aggregate(`max`, [toExpression(arg)]); } const comparisonFunctions = [ `eq`, `gt`, `gte`, `lt`, `lte`, `in`, `like`, `ilike` ]; export { add, and, avg, coalesce, comparisonFunctions, concat, count, eq, gt, gte, ilike, inArray, length, like, lower, lt, lte, max, min, not, or, sum, upper }; //# sourceMappingURL=functions.js.map
